Effect of oxygen pressure on the thermochemical properties of PrMnO3

The static method and thermal analysis are used to study the thermal stability of compound PrMnO 3 . The equilibrium oxygen pressure of the dissociation reaction is measured and the thermodynamic characteristics of the reaction with the formation of PrMnO 3 from its elements are calculated.
